Live Steam player count comparison, updated every 10 minutes. Both are Action games.
World of Warships is currently the more played game: 6,106 concurrent players on Steam right now vs 3,448 for Counter-Strike: Source, about 1.8× more players. World of Warships has been ahead for 46 days straight, and has led on 50 days of the 78 days Coilr has tracked both games. Counter-Strike: Source counters with better Steam reviews: 96% positive vs 76%. World of Warships is free to play, while Counter-Strike: Source costs $9.99. Across all tracked metrics, World of Warships leads 7 of 10.
These are Steam players only. A game that also runs on its own launcher, a storefront of its own or on console has players this number cannot see, so read it as a comparison of Steam audiences rather than of total ones.

How this works: each game's daily average concurrent players (from Coilr's 10-minute Steam polls), compared on the 78 days where both games have data. Whichever averages higher leads that day. methodology
| Metric | Counter-Strike: Source | World of Warships |
|---|---|---|
| Players right now | 3,448 | 6,106 |
| 24-hour peak | 3,798 | 11,854 |
| 7-day average | 2,357 | 7,313 |
| 30-day average | 2,354 | 7,157 |
| 30-day trend | −71% | +2% |
| Peak (tracked) | 37,913 | 62,328 |
| Steam reviews | 96% positive | 76% positive |
| Recent reviews (3 mo) | 95% positive | 66% positive |
| Total reviews | 192,835 | 156,131 |
| Owners (SteamSpy est.) | ~10,000,000 | ~20,000,000 |
| Release date | Nov 1, 2004 | Nov 15, 2017 |
| Price | $9.99 | Free to play |
